How Should You Approach an E-Commerce POS Integration?

Fabric Blog

Point of sale (POS) systems are an essential part of physical retail. The systems also track in-store inventory and collect valuable customer data. Your POS systems must integrate with your e-commerce tech stack to accomplish true omnichannel commerce and access these benefits.
